**Q: How do team assistants get into the pop-up office at the Meridale Trade Fair?**

The pop-up office is behind Stand 14 in Hall B, staffed 08:00–18:00 during fair days. Regular Corvane badges do not work there. Assistants handling materials or guest passes should use the keypad on the rear door. The code rotates daily; today's is posted below and in the stand logbook.

door code, yagap-bahof: bdg-O-05

Ticket VR-2281 — Marigold shared component library version skew. Severity: high. Three consumer apps pinned to 4.x while the registry resolved a 5.0 prerelease due to a bad dist-tag. Result: broken button styles in two production surfaces. Fix: corrected the tag, added a registry lint step blocking prerelease defaults. Needs your sign-off before we republish; consumers must pin exact versions going forward. Verification should be done against the artifact identified by the token below.

session token of yajof-bagef = htk4_937d

## Tuning

The Quillhopper bounce processor is mostly hands-off, but a few knobs matter. Hard bounces get suppressed immediately; soft bounces go through a retry ladder before we give up. The retry window and batch size were picked after the great Fennel Mail backlog of last spring, so don't shrink them casually. If the queue starts lagging, bump the worker count before touching anything else. Everything lives in one config block so you can't miss it. Here are the current defaults.

tuning table, hafog-bahaf:
QUOTAS = {
    "praion": 144,
    "briax": 906,
    "silwyn": 451,
}